  • @scgtlp When Kristin sings it, her first note in the song is D#. And then there's a key change. And when she sings with Matthew, her first note is G. And when she hit's that high note (that she does so well), its a high Bb. When Shirley sings it, she starts on F#. There is no key change. And her high note is just an F# up the octave. So, the two versions are in totally different keys. Kristin and Shirley are both incredibly amazing and Im in love with them both and both versions of the movie. :D
